New Delhi, Mar 28 (ANI): Actor Vivek Oberoi along with his lawyer appeared before Election Commission of India on Thursday regarding the release of biopic 'PM Narendra Modi'. While speaking to ANI Vivek Oberoi's lawyer Hitesh Jain said, "We have filed our detailed response to the show cause notice received from the Election Commission. We have submitted that biopic 'PM Narendra Modi' is not in violation of model code of conduct." Earlier, a delegation of the Congress and the CPI(M) met Election Commission officials and demanded that release of the film based on the life of Prime Minister Narendra Modi to be deferred, claiming it to be a 'Propaganda Material' and the violation of Model Code of Conduct (MCC).

Dehradun (Uttarakhand), Mar 28 (ANI): A 12-yr-old student was beaten to death by two of his seniors at a boarding school in Dehradun. Five people have been arrested so far in connection with the crime. Speaking to mediapersons, SSP Dehradun Nivedita Kukreti said, "Postmortem report revealed internal injury shock as cause of death of the student. After investigation, it came to light that two senior students had beaten him up. The hostel authorities have also hidden this fact during initial inquiry and later during investigation other students have revealed the truth. So far, five person including two students have been arrested."

New Delhi, Mar 28 (ANI): It is easy for women to change dresses even at the last minute before going out if something doesn't fit right. However, for International Space Station astronauts an ill-fitted spacesuit marred what would have been a historic all-women spacewalk. The spacewalk was scheduled for this week, with only female astronauts for the first time ever. The spacewalk was supposed to include astronaut Anne McClain, but there was an issue with the fit and availability of her spacesuit. As NASA explains in its blog, McClain was supposed to conduct the spacewalk with Christina Koch on March 29. However, McClain's learned that a medium-size hard upper torso, which is the shirt of the spacesuit, fit her best and only one such torso can be made ready by Friday, Koch will wear it and conduct the spacewalk with Nick Hague.
